Beyond the Buzzwords: 42 AI Concepts Every Developer Should Know

AI is everywhere from APIs and databases to IDE plugins and code copilots. Yet even experienced developers often find AI jargon confusing or overlapping: embeddings, LLMs, tokens, transformers, diffusion models, RAG, LoRA…

This session cuts through the noise with a developer-focused walkthrough of 42 essential AI terms you should know to confidently read documentation, design AI-integrated systems, and have informed conversations about architecture and ethics.

We’ll group concepts into themes: Models, Data, Training, Inference, Evaluation, and Deployment. You’ll walk away with a solid working vocabulary, mental models for how AI fits into modern software stacks, and a quick-reference glossary to take home.
